ICICI Lombard General Insurance Company Limited has disclosed the transcript of its earnings conference call for the quarter and nine months ended December 31, 2025, in compliance with regulatory requirements. The company submitted this disclosure to both BSE and NSE on January 19, 2026, under Regulation 30 of S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015.

Earnings Call Details

The earnings conference call was hosted on January 13, 2026, where the company engaged with investors and analysts to discuss its financial performance for the specified period. This follows the company's earlier communications dated January 6, 2026, and January 13, 2026, regarding the same matter.

Parameter: Details
Call Date: January 13, 2026
Reporting Period: Q3FY26 and nine months ended December 31, 2025
Disclosure Date: January 19, 2026
Regulation: SEBI Regulation 30

ICICI Lombard General Insurance Company recorded a major block trade on NSE worth ₹18.51 crores, involving approximately 100,005 shares at ₹1,850.90 per share. The transaction demonstrates significant institutional activity and strategic positioning in the insurance sector through the block trading mechanism.

ICICI Lombard General Insurance Company witnessed a significant block trade on the National Stock Exchange (NSE), highlighting notable institutional activity in the insurance sector. The transaction represents a substantial movement in the company's shares through the block trading mechanism.

Block Trade Details

The block trade executed on NSE involved considerable volume and value, demonstrating institutional investor participation in ICICI Lombard General Insurance shares.

Parameter: Details
Total Transaction Value: ₹18.51 crores
Number of Shares: ~100,005 shares
Price per Share: ₹1,850.90
Exchange: NSE

Market Significance

Block trades represent large-volume transactions typically executed by institutional investors, mutual funds, or other significant market participants. These transactions are conducted outside the regular market to minimize price impact while facilitating substantial share transfers.

The execution price of ₹1,850.90 per share reflects the prevailing market conditions at the time of the transaction. Such block trades often indicate strategic positioning by institutional investors or portfolio rebalancing activities.
